Have recorded this particular talk, despite its being delivered in a candid way, thought of sharing it, hoping that it may become a source for someone to feel better and relieved.
May Allah swt forgive my shortcomings
Elevate yourself through the beautiful lessons from surah Ad Duha
Please click the audio link below to go through some of the reflections from surah Ad Duha.
Rahmatul lil Aalameen..